The 55-acre ranch was purchased by a couple by the name of Lee and Ruth McReynolds who transformed it into a western town in order to catch the overflow from the highly successful Iverson Movie Ranch. Leno LaBianca, a grocer, and his wife Rosemary were murdered at their home early on Aug. 10, 1969.
